WTIC said it received information about the Dec. 8 incident and obtained footage of the incident after filing a Freedom of Information request.
According to WTIC, Thomas Broclio, 37, drove his company car while recording his dashcam when he approached a Toyota Tacoma in front of him at a red light at the intersection of France Avenue and Cromwell Avenue in Rocky Hill. I was driving.
“What are we doing?” Broculio asked as the Tacoma driver honked his horn in hopes of making a right turn.

“I’ve been waiting all day!” Broculio yelled, according to the dashcam. Police said Broculio immediately pointed the finger at the truck driver.
Then Meriden Police Corporal Gunter, 57, who was off-duty at the time, got out of the Tacoma and approached Broculio’s car, his badge flashing.

Gunter, who has more than 20 years of law enforcement experience, was about to make his first embarrassing mistake, the department said.
“You can’t take the right on red, you son of a bitch,” Gunter told Broculio, according to WTIC.
The problem for Gunter was that the sign didn’t convey that – and Broculio quickly noticed Gunter’s gaffe.
“Really? Where does it say that? It says, ‘Stop here on red,'” Broculio replied. Motorists can make a right turn on red if there is a sign that says stop here on red.
Gunter immediately began taking photos of Broculio’s license plate. Broculio accused Mr. Gunter of making the phone calls. Gunter then issued Brocurio a ticket and threatened to call his boss, WTIC reported.
“Of course. That’s good,” Broculio replied. “Please tell me your badge number.”
Broculio got a knuckle sandwich instead. Gunter punched Broculio in the face, the station said. That was the officer’s second mistake.

According to the bureau, Gunter taunted Broculio and asked her, “Who do you think you are? Do you want to be arrested?”
Broculio, looking shocked, replied: “You will be arrested for assaulting a civilian.”

According to WTIC, Gunter drove away and Broculio called 911, telling dispatchers, “I was assaulted by a police officer. He punched me in the face through the window.”
Rocky Hill police responded and filed an incident report stating that the punch left Broculio “dazed and possibly suffering a concussion,” the department said in a statement.
In addition, Rocky Hill police body camera video shows them confronting each other at Gunter’s residence, WTIC reported.
“Is he charging me with a violation or something like that because I yelled at him?” Gunter asked one of the Rocky Hill police officers.

“It’s an assault charge because you hit him,” the Rocky Hill police officer replied.
“Is he saying I hit him?” Gunter replied.

“Yes,” the Rocky Hill police officer replied. “And he has a video of you hitting him.”
Remarkably, Mr. Gunter asked Rocky Hill police officers if they could press charges against Mr. Brocurzio. “He’s yelling at me and there’s nothing I can claim as a violation. Whatever it is?”

Gunter, a school resource officer at Thomas Edison Middle School in Meriden, was charged with breach of peace and third-degree assault, WTIC said.
Interior officials said Gunter violated the department’s rules of conduct and was suspended without pay for five days and required to attend de-escalation training for three consecutive years, the department said.
“When Corporal Gunter assumed administrative duties, he was also removed from his duties as a school resource officer, and as a result of the discipline handed down as part of the IA investigation, Corporal Gunter was permanently removed from his position. He will be assigned the duties of an SRO,” the ministry added in a statement to WTIC.
